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Patriots Park is strategically located in the heart of Allentown, Pennsylvania, easily accessible via major roadways. Situated west of downtown and nestled within a well-established residential and recreational district, it serves as a key community asset. The park is bordered by Wyoming Street to the north and Union Boulevard to the south, with main access points off these thoroughfares. Nearby major highways include the Lehigh Valley Thruway (I-476) and Route 22, providing direct routes for those traveling into the city. Driving times from Lehigh Valley International Airport (ABE), located about a 15-20 minute drive northeast, are generally straightforward, though traffic can increase during peak commute hours. Public transportation options within Allentown are available, with bus routes serving the main arteries near the park, offering an alternative for those not driving. For arriving teams and families, understanding these access points and potential traffic patterns, especially on event days, is crucial for timely arrival and minimizing stress. Planning to arrive at least 30-45 minutes before scheduled events is advisable to allow ample time for parking, unloading gear, and finding your designated field or facility.

Section 05

Things to Do

Walkable

Hike & Bike Trail (Lehigh Canal Towpath)

On site

Patriots Park offers direct access to sections of the historic Lehigh Canal Towpath, providing a scenic and peaceful escape from the athletic fields. This well-maintained trail is perfect for a brisk walk, a relaxing jog, or a leisurely bike ride. It’s an ideal spot for players to stretch their legs between games or for families looking for a quiet activity. The flat terrain makes it accessible for all fitness levels, and you can enjoy views of the canal and surrounding natural beauty. Remember to bring water and wear comfortable shoes for your exploration along the towpath.

Allentown Rose Garden

0.5 mi

Adjacent to and bordering Patriots Park, the Allentown Rose Garden is a beautifully landscaped oasis featuring thousands of rose bushes in bloom throughout the season. It’s a tranquil setting for a quiet stroll, offering a pleasant contrast to the energetic sports environment. The garden provides shaded benches perfect for reading or simply enjoying the colorful displays and fragrant air. It's an excellent place for families to relax, take photos, or enjoy a peaceful moment away from the fields, especially during warmer months.

5–15 Minutes Away

Da Vinci Science Center

2.1 mi

For an engaging and educational experience, especially on a rainy day or as a break from sports, the Da Vinci Science Center in downtown Allentown is a fantastic choice. This interactive museum offers hands-on exhibits focused on science, technology, engineering, art, and math (STEAM). It’s designed to spark curiosity and encourage exploration for visitors of all ages, making it a fun outing for families and younger players. Plan for at least 2-3 hours to fully explore the exhibits and participate in any demonstrations.

Coca-Cola Park

2.5 mi

Home to the Lehigh Valley IronPigs, the Triple-A affiliate of the Philadelphia Phillies, Coca-Cola Park offers more than just baseball games. It's a modern stadium with various dining options and a lively atmosphere that can serve as a great spot for a team meal or a fun evening outing. Even when there isn't a game, the surrounding area can be lively, and it offers a taste of local sports culture. Check their schedule for games or special events that might coincide with your visit, providing a change of pace from park play.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Allentown br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the 30s and 40s Fahrenheit. Snowfall is common, and outdoor sports activities at Patriots Park are minimal to non-existent. Visitors should pack heavy coats, hats, gloves, and warm layers for any necessary outdoor excursions. Park trails may be icy or snow-covered, requiring caution.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er offer mild to warm weather, with temperatures gradually increasing from the 50s to the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Rain showers are frequent, so packing a light waterproof jacket or umbrella is wise. Comfortable athletic wear is suitable for games, with layers recommended for cooler mornings or evenings. It’s an ideal time for outdoor sports with pleasant conditions.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er (July-August) brings the warmest temperatures, often reaching into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, with high humidity. Hydration is critical during this period; ensure athletes and spectators drink plenty of water. Light, breathable clothing is essential. Sunscreen and hats are highly recommended for extended periods outdoors, as the sun can be intense.

🍂

Fall season

Fall provides crisp, cool air and beautiful foliage, with daytime temperatures typically 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it. This is a very popular time for sports tournaments. Layers are key, as mornings can be chilly, warming up considerably by the afternoon. A light jacket or sweatshirt is usually sufficient for comfort during games.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ur in any season, often leading to game delays or cancellations; always check local weather advisories and event status. Snowfall is primarily a winter concern, making outdoor play impossible. Be prepared for varying conditions by checking forecasts immediately before your visit and packing accordingly for comfort and safety.
